StartApp正在加载android应用程序

StartApp正在加载android应用程序,android,startapp,Android,Startapp,我的android应用程序在模拟器上运行良好,广告出现并正常工作,等等,当我使用eclipse adt在手机上测试它时,但当它从play store下载时,它立即崩溃,给出logcat输出: 09-28 18:50:21.280: E/AndroidRuntime(17895): FATAL EXCEPTION: main 09-28 18:50:21.280: E/AndroidRuntime(17895): Process: com.jakebarnby.pop, PID: 17895 09

我的android应用程序在模拟器上运行良好,广告出现并正常工作,等等,当我使用eclipse adt在手机上测试它时,但当它从play store下载时,它立即崩溃,给出logcat输出:

09-28 18:50:21.280: E/AndroidRuntime(17895): FATAL EXCEPTION: main
09-28 18:50:21.280: E/AndroidRuntime(17895): Process: com.jakebarnby.pop, PID: 17895
09-28 18:50:21.280: E/AndroidRuntime(17895): java.lang.AssertionError
09-28 18:50:21.280: E/AndroidRuntime(17895):    at com.startapp.android.publish.i.b.a.bf.<init>(Unknown Source)
09-28 18:50:21.280: E/AndroidRuntime(17895):    at com.startapp.android.publish.i.b.a.as.a(Unknown Source)
09-28 18:50:21.280: E/AndroidRuntime(17895):    at com.startapp.android.publish.i.j.a(Unknown Source)
09-28 18:50:21.280: E/AndroidRuntime(17895):    at com.startapp.android.publish.i.b.a.q.<init>(Unknown Source)
09-28 18:50:21.280: E/AndroidRuntime(17895):    at com.startapp.android.publish.i.b.a.p.a(Unknown Source)
09-28 18:50:21.280: E/AndroidRuntime(17895):    at com.startapp.android.publish.i.b.a.p.a(Unknown Source)
09-28 18:50:21.280: E/AndroidRuntime(17895):    at com.startapp.android.publish.i.b.a.p.a(Unknown Source)
09-28 18:50:21.280: E/AndroidRuntime(17895):    at com.startapp.android.publish.i.j.a(Unknown  Source)
09-28 18:50:21.280: E/AndroidRuntime(17895):    at com.startapp.android.publish.i.j.a(Unknown Source)
09-28 18:50:21.280: E/AndroidRuntime(17895):    at com.startapp.android.publish.i.j.a(Unknown Source)
09-28 18:50:21.280: E/AndroidRuntime(17895):    at com.startapp.android.publish.i.j.a(Unknown Source)
09-28 18:50:21.280: E/AndroidRuntime(17895):    at com.startapp.android.publish.i.j.a(Unknown   Source)
09-28 18:50:21.280: E/AndroidRuntime(17895):    at com.startapp.android.publish.o.b(Unknown Source)
09-28 18:50:21.280: E/AndroidRuntime(17895):    at com.startapp.android.publish.o.a(Unknown Source)
09-28 18:50:21.280: E/AndroidRuntime(17895):    at com.startapp.android.publish.o.a(Unknown Source)
09-28 18:50:21.280: E/AndroidRuntime(17895):    at jakebarnby.pop.MainActivity.onCreate(Unknown Source)
09-28 18:50:21.280: E/AndroidRuntime(17895):    at android.app.Activity.performCreate(Activity.java:5312)
09-28 18:50:21.280: E/AndroidRuntime(17895):    at android.app.Instrumentation.callActivityOnCreate(Instrumentation.java:1087)
09-28 18:50:21.280: E/AndroidRuntime(17895):    at android.app.ActivityThread.performLaunchActivity(ActivityThread.java:2181)
09-28 18:50:21.280: E/AndroidRuntime(17895):    at     android.app.ActivityThread.handleLaunchActivity(ActivityThread.java:2276)
09-28 18:50:21.280: E/AndroidRuntime(17895):    at android.app.ActivityThread.access$800(ActivityThread.java:144)
09-28 18:50:21.280: E/AndroidRuntime(17895):    at android.app.ActivityThread$H.handleMessage(ActivityThread.java:1205)
09-28 18:50:21.280: E/AndroidRuntime(17895):    at android.os.Handler.dispatchMessage(Handler.java:102)
09-28 18:50:21.280: E/AndroidRuntime(17895):    at android.os.Looper.loop(Looper.java:136)
09-28 18:50:21.280: E/AndroidRuntime(17895):    at android.app.ActivityThread.main(ActivityThread.java:5146)
09-28 18:50:21.280: E/AndroidRuntime(17895):    at java.lang.reflect.Method.invokeNative(Native Method)
09-28 18:50:21.280: E/AndroidRuntime(17895):    at java.lang.reflect.Method.invoke(Method.java:515)
09-28 18:50:21.280: E/AndroidRuntime(17895):    at com.android.internal.os.ZygoteInit$MethodAndArgsCaller.run(ZygoteInit.java:796)
09-28 18:50:21.280: E/AndroidRuntime(17895):    at com.android.internal.os.ZygoteInit.main(ZygoteInit.java:612)
09-28 18:50:21.280: E/AndroidRuntime(17895):    at dalvik.system.NativeStart.main(Native Method)
09-2818:50:21.280:E/AndroidRuntime(17895):致命异常:main
09-28 18:50:21.280:E/AndroidRuntime(17895):进程:com.jakebarnby.pop,PID:17895
09-28 18:50:21.280:E/AndroidRuntime(17895):java.lang.AssertionError
09-28 18:50:21.280:E/AndroidRuntime(17895):在com.startapp.android.publish.i.b.a.bf(未知来源)
09-28 18:50:21.280:E/AndroidRuntime(17895):在com.startapp.android.publish.i.b.a.as.a(未知来源)
09-28 18:50:21.280:E/AndroidRuntime(17895):在com.startapp.android.publish.i.j.a(未知来源)
09-28 18:50:21.280:E/AndroidRuntime(17895):在com.startapp.android.publish.i.b.a.q.(未知来源)
09-28 18:50:21.280:E/AndroidRuntime(17895):在com.startapp.android.publish.i.b.a.p.a(未知来源)
09-28 18:50:21.280:E/AndroidRuntime(17895):在com.startapp.android.publish.i.b.a.p.a(未知来源)
09-28 18:50:21.280:E/AndroidRuntime(17895):在com.startapp.android.publish.i.b.a.p.a(未知来源)
09-28 18:50:21.280:E/AndroidRuntime(17895):在com.startapp.android.publish.i.j.a(未知来源)
09-28 18:50:21.280:E/AndroidRuntime(17895):在com.startapp.android.publish.i.j.a(未知来源)
09-28 18:50:21.280:E/AndroidRuntime(17895):在com.startapp.android.publish.i.j.a(未知来源)
09-28 18:50:21.280:E/AndroidRuntime(17895):在com.startapp.android.publish.i.j.a(未知来源)
09-28 18:50:21.280:E/AndroidRuntime(17895):在com.startapp.android.publish.i.j.a(未知来源)
09-28 18:50:21.280:E/AndroidRuntime(17895):在com.startapp.android.publish.o.b(未知来源)
09-28 18:50:21.280:E/AndroidRuntime(17895):在com.startapp.android.publish.o.a(未知来源)
09-28 18:50:21.280:E/AndroidRuntime(17895):在com.startapp.android.publish.o.a(未知来源)
09-28 18:50:21.280:E/AndroidRuntime(17895):在jakebarnby.pop.MainActivity.onCreate(未知来源)
09-28 18:50:21.280:E/AndroidRuntime(17895):在android.app.Activity.performCreate(Activity.java:5312)上
09-28 18:50:21.280:E/AndroidRuntime(17895):在android.app.Instrumentation.callActivityOnCreate(Instrumentation.java:1087)上
09-28 18:50:21.280:E/AndroidRuntime(17895):在android.app.ActivityThread.performLaunchActivity(ActivityThread.java:2181)
09-28 18:50:21.280:E/AndroidRuntime(17895):在android.app.ActivityThread.handleLaunchActivity(ActivityThread.java:2276)
09-28 18:50:21.280:E/AndroidRuntime(17895):在android.app.ActivityThread.access$800(ActivityThread.java:144)
09-28 18:50:21.280:E/AndroidRuntime(17895):在android.app.ActivityThread$H.handleMessage(ActivityThread.java:1205)
09-28 18:50:21.280:E/AndroidRuntime(17895):在android.os.Handler.dispatchMessage(Handler.java:102)上
09-28 18:50:21.280:E/AndroidRuntime(17895):在android.os.Looper.loop(Looper.java:136)上
09-28 18:50:21.280:E/AndroidRuntime(17895):位于android.app.ActivityThread.main(ActivityThread.java:5146)
09-28 18:50:21.280:E/AndroidRuntime(17895):位于java.lang.reflect.Method.Invokenactive(本机方法)
09-28 18:50:21.280:E/AndroidRuntime(17895):位于java.lang.reflect.Method.invoke(Method.java:515)
09-28 18:50:21.280:E/AndroidRuntime(17895):在com.android.internal.os.ZygoteInit$MethodAndArgsCaller.run(ZygoteInit.java:796)
09-28 18:50:21.280:E/AndroidRuntime(17895):位于com.android.internal.os.ZygoteInit.main(ZygoteInit.java:612)
09-28 18:50:21.280:E/AndroidRuntime(17895):在dalvik.system.NativeStart.main(本机方法)

我不知道为什么。非常感谢您的帮助

您的proguard是否已启用?如果是,您必须添加startapp的模糊代码。它是由他们的文档编写的。是链接。代码是从那里复制的

-keep class com.startapp.** {
      *;
}

-keepattributes Exceptions, InnerClasses, Signature, Deprecated, SourceFile,
LineNumberTable, *Annotation*, EnclosingMethod
-dontwarn android.webkit.JavascriptInterface
-dontwarn com.startapp.**

你是否正在android studio中构建你的应用程序??你的项目中是否有
.idea
文件??如果
startapp
的代码失败,则执行
断言。确保已正确集成startapp的库。我使用的是Eclipse ADT,没有
。idea
文件确保您遵循了集成手册中的混淆部分: